Supervised self-collected SARS-CoV-2 testing in indoor summer camps to inform school reopening
2020-10-23
Abstract excerpt
<h4>Background and Objectives</h4> Testing strategies for sever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) infection in school settings are needed to assess the efficacy of infection mitigation strategies and inform school reopening policies.
